About Patient Choice:

At Patient Choice, we are committed to delivering better healthcare experiences by providing NHS prescription products that benefit both patients and the NHS. As a trusted supplier with a proven track record, our mission is simple: to provide the best deal for patients and the NHS.

As we continue to grow our digital platforms and invest in exciting new technology, design plays a critical role in how healthcare professionals and patients experience and access our services. We are now looking for a talented Graphic Designer to help bring that experience to life through high-quality, thoughtful and consistent creative design.

The Role:

We are hiring for an enthusiastic midweight Graphic Designer to take full ownership of the creative design. You will support marketing campaigns and wider initiatives that shape how nurses and patients experience Patient Choice. You will be passionate about how your creative design can drive meaningful impact within healthcare.

You will join a friendly marketing team of three, where you will be able to collaborate, contribute ideas, concepts and create high quality design work.
